Most shoppers compare male chastity devices by material, lock style, and day-to-day comfort. Common options include:- Stainless steel: weighty feel, durable, easy wipe-down hygiene.
- Polycarbonate: lightweight, discreet, often more “budget friendly” for long wear.
- Silicone: flexible comfort for some bodies, but fit and stability vary by design.
- Chastity Lock + key style (classic keyholder dynamic)
- Integrated lock styles (built-in lock systems)
- Padlock styles (simple to replace, simple to check)
How a chastity device should feel on the body
A good cage fit is snug, not painful. Expect awareness, not sharp pressure. Your goal is a stable setup for a flaccid penis that doesn’t pinch skin or compress the base ring.Chastity cage comfort checklist for flaccid wear
- No skin pinching around the base ring
- No numbness or sharp pressure on the testicles
- Minimal rubbing during walking and sitting
- A lock that sits cleanly without digging in
Chastity Cage Sizes | Measurement, Back Ring Sizes & Fit Steps
Sizing is the difference between “this works” and “I can’t wear it.” Start with measurement—then match your results to cage sizes and ring options. Key fit points:- Back ring sizes (base ring): most important comfort variable
- Cage length (for flaccid containment, not forced tightness)
- Gap/spacing (reduces pinching; improves long-wear comfort)
Common fit mistakes (and how to avoid them)
- Buying based on “looks” instead of sizing
- Choosing steel when you want lightweight discretion (or vice versa)
- Skipping daily hygiene planning
Chastity Cage Cleaning & Hygiene
Hygiene is non-negotiable for long wear. Build a routine that’s simple enough to follow:- Daily wash and dry (especially around the base ring area)
- Use a compatible sex toy cleaner on the cage
- Keep skin dry and avoid friction hotspots
- Inspect lock areas and hinge points

What lock style should I pick for a chastity device?
Choose a lock based on control and convenience. A classic key suits keyholder play, while integrated designs can feel cleaner. Options like barrel lock, hexlock, or other advanced systems prioritize security and daily comfort.How should a chastity cage feel during daily wear?
A cage should feel snug, not painful. For a flaccid fit, you want stable containment with no pinching, numbness, or sharp pressure on the base ring or testicles. If discomfort appears, treat it like a sizing issue, not a “training” goal.How do I measure for cage sizes and back ring sizes?
Start with measurement for back ring sizes, then choose cage length for flaccid containment—not forced tightness. Do a short test wear at home and check walking, sitting, stairs, and bathroom comfort. If it rubs, resize before longer wear.Are chastity cages the same as a chastity belt?
No. A female chastity belt or chastity cage belt typically covers more area and can feel more “full coverage,” while a male chastity cage is smaller and easier to size for most beginners. Belts often require more fit adjustment and planning.
